PostPosted: Fri Jun 15, 2007 1:22 pm    Post subject: The Speed Camera capital of Europe Reply with quote

So says that fine oracle, the Daily Mail.

http://www.dailymail.co.uk/pages/live/articles/news/news.html?in_article_id=462087&in_page_id=1770&ct=5

They say that speed cameras have done virtually nothing to improve road safetly and claim that drink driving and a lack of "real" (ie non-robotised) traffic policing is a major problem.

Due to our lack of improvement, we no longer have the safest roads in Europe.

PostPosted: Fri Jun 15, 2007 4:18 pm    Post subject: Reply with quote

The multiplication of speed cameras is no surprise to any of us, as numerous threads on the subject and the rise of the pgpsw database here can confirm.
This is more proof that speed cameras are just a "cash cow".

Although on the face of the survey the UK's shows that at 54 death's per million, it is one of the highest in Europe, as with all these figure's in survey's, it doesn't really tell us a lot.

What does that figure mean?
You need to know the % of drivers on the road per million to give it something to compare it to!

You can take it a step further and compare it with Africa, where for instance in Sierra Leone it is only 16 deaths per million, the nearest African country to ours is Tanzania at 52 and Ghana at 56 per million, but we all know that very few people per million drive in these countries and if you have seen the roads as i have, the driving standards and deaths are a lot worse % per person, here in the UK, there are a lot more road users per million, nearly every household has a vehicle of some type - additionally which, there are all the extra 1000's of lorry's, buses etc on the road added on top.

I feel this is just another set of figures to make a newspaper story.

Yes we all can all understand that drink drivers has increased, also drugged drivers, with no noticeable police presence nobody is surprised, all the speed camera's do is earn cash from the motorists going about there ordinary lives.

I have often driven from one side of the UK to the other and haven't seen any police, including on the countries biggest race track (as well as car park) the M25, JUST CAMERA'S.

PostPosted: Wed Jun 27, 2007 12:20 am    Post subject: Re: The Speed Camera capital of Europe Reply with quote

Skippy wrote:
So says that fine oracle, the Daily Mail.

http://www.dailymail.co.uk/pages/live/articles/news/news.html?in_article_id=462087&in_page_id=1770&ct=5

They say that speed cameras have done virtually nothing to improve road safetly and claim that drink driving and a lack of "real" (ie non-robotised) traffic policing is a major problem.

Due to our lack of improvement, we no longer have the safest roads in Europe.


The article says that there are 4875 cameras on British Roads, which makes our camera database figures interesting:

There are a total of 11,060 verified cameras in the database and 1,242 unverified mobile sites (total combined: 12,303). 3,910 Gatso/Monitron/Truvelo/RedSpeed, 5,887 Mobiles, 5 Temporary, 258 Specs and 999 Redlight Cameras.
